EROSION CONTROL <br /> Chapter 14 ' " <br /> Dane County Code of Ordinances <br /> SECTION 14.53 APPLICABILITY OF REQUIREMENT FOR EROSION CONTROL PLANS. <br /> (1) Projects located in the R-4, A-B, B-1, C-1, C-2, LC-1 & M-1 Districts and <br /> which have an area in excess of 20,000 square feet that is disturbed by landscaping <br /> or construction of buildings, parking lots, drives or sidewalks are subject to <br /> Sections 14.51 through 14.99 of this Ordinance. <br /> • <br /> 14.54 REQUIREMENTS OF EROSION CONTROL PLANS. An erosion control <br /> plan required under this section 14.53 shall consist of the <br /> following: <br /> (1) cross section of road ditches; <br /> (2) profile within road ditches; <br /> (3) culvert sizes; <br /> (4) direction of flow of runoff; <br /> (5) watershed size for each drainage area; <br /> (6) design discharge for ditches and structural measures; <br /> (7) runoff velocities; <br /> (8) fertilizer and seeding rates and recommendations; <br /> (9) time schedule for seeding; design and location of erosion <br /> control measures; <br /> (10) method by which the lot(s) are to be developed; <br /> (11) plans for disturbing the area and for re-vegetation; and <br /> (12) a statement as to how any runoff resulting from construction <br /> will effect areas outside of the plat. <br /> 14.55 FILING OF EROSION CONTROL PLAN. Any person applying for a <br /> zoning permit in any district subject to section 14. 53 shall, as. <br /> part of the zoning permit application process, submit an erosion <br /> control plan meeting the requirements of section 14. 54 . The <br /> Zoning Administrator shall review the plan for completeness. A <br /> zoning permit may not be issued if the plan is not submitted or <br /> is deficient in content. The issuance of a zoning permit shall <br /> be withheld pending review of the plan. <br /> 14.56 ADMINISTRATION AND ENFORCEMENT. (1) The Zoning <br /> Administrator shall forward the plan to LCC staff . for <br /> review and comment. LCC • staff shall review the plan purusant to <br /> the Soil Conservation Service Technical Guide as adopted by Dane <br /> County and notify the Zoning Administrator of any deficiency in <br /> the plan. <br /> (2) The Zoning Administrator shall inform the applicant for a <br /> zoning permit of any deficiency in the plan and the applicant <br /> shall correct any such deficiency in the plan before the zoning <br /> permit is issued. <br /> -1- <br />
